Embodiment 1

[0019] Take 500g of peony stems, cut them into small sections with a length of 5-10cm, wash them with deionized water, remove the impurities in them, and dry the water at 40-50°C; split the dried peony stems into strips and cut them into lengths 2-3cm small pieces, pulverized with a pulverizer, sealed and stored after passing through a 60-mesh sieve; weighed 30g of peony stem powder, added 300mL of 5% NaOH solution, and heated and stirred in a water bath at 80°C for 4 hours to remove part of the lignin and half Cellulose, obtain a suspension after cooling; the suspension is centrifuged at a speed of 8000r / min for 10min, the supernatant is discarded, and 15g of the precipitate is added to 225mL of 4% H 2 o 2 solution, in a water bath at 60°C for 1 hour; the suspension was centrifuged at a speed of 8,000r / min for 10 minutes, and the supernatant was discarded after standing; after the sediment was centrifugally washed to neutrality, it was dried in a drying oven at 105°C and pulv...

Abstract

The invention relates to a preparation method of peony stem nano-cellulose for oil and belongs to the technical field of energy and chemical materials. The method comprises the following steps: performing oxidation treatment on a peony stem which serves as an initial raw material through mild base, and bleaching the peony stem by hydrogen peroxide to obtain peony stem cellulose; then performing acidolysis on the peony stem cellulose which serves as the raw material to prepare the peony stem nano-cellulose. A production process is simple, achievement transformation is facilitated, the comprehensive utilization value of peony can be well increased, the aim of making the most of things is achieved, and the requirements of a national strategy of sustainable development are met. technical field [0001] The invention relates to a method for preparing peony stem nanocellulose for oil, and belongs to the technical field of energy and chemical materials. Background technique [0002] Cellulose is the most abundant biodegradable and renewable natural polymer material in the world. In today's world facing the situation of rapid resource consumption and environmental degradation, it is of great strategic significance to focus on the development of renewable cellulose resources. [0003] Peony stems and peony seed shells, as by-products of peony processing, are mainly composed of cellulose, which is a new type of cellulose biological resource with great utilization value. However, at present, most of peony stems and peony shells are burned as dry firewood, which not only causes great waste of resources and huge economic losses, but also causes relatively serious environmental pollution.
